Genealogy Schenkenberg van Mierop » Jan van der Haer (1573-1646)

Personal data Jan van der Haer 

  • He was born on October 5, 1573.
  • He died on November 4, 1646 in 's Gravenhage, he was 73 years old.
  • This information was last updated on August 2, 2008.

Household of Jan van der Haer

He is married to Maria van Kinschot.

They got married on March 14, 1607 at 's Gravenhage, he was 33 years old.

vier kinderen

Jan van der Haer 1609-1665
Mr. Gasper van der Haer 1613-1678
Mr. Nicolaas van der Haer 1620-1708
Vincentia van der Haer 1630-1685
